Output 8560eb13870c49db0e28d2c4ff2d9327708f4a9b9e1bab3b3e64890755ad0090:0

value
17503
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d7ab46ca3381ecb988d2938c0d378674d3891bce OP_EQUALVERIFY OP_CHECKSIG
address
1LfMTkD71yedf8xUfJnrbaKkwCqiN3iqbh
transaction
8560eb13870c49db0e28d2c4ff2d9327708f4a9b9e1bab3b3e64890755ad0090
confirmations
220776
spent
true